🔧 Troubleshooting Injection Molding #12 – Gate Blush

One small white mark around the gate can tell you a lot about your process.
The challenge is knowing what to look for first.

Gate Blush is a whitish or dull area visible around the gate, typically caused by unstable fountain flow or excessive shear during cavity filling.

When troubleshooting Gate Blush, investigate the causes in the right order:

1️⃣ Excessive shear at the gate (most common root cause)
➡ Verify the injection speed profile and gate dimensions. Reduce the initial filling speed or increase the gate size if possible.

2️⃣ Gate design too restrictive
➡ Inspect the gate thickness, gate land length and gate type. A small or restrictive gate creates excessive shear and unstable melt flow.

3️⃣ Incorrect melt or mold temperature
➡ Measure the actual melt and mold temperatures. Both excessively low and excessively high melt temperatures can contribute to Gate Blush. Optimize the process based on measured values rather than machine settings.

4️⃣ Improper filling profile
➡ Avoid maximum injection speed at the beginning of filling. A slower initial filling stage often improves fountain flow and eliminates the defect.

5️⃣ Premature gate freeze or insufficient packing
➡ Verify holding pressure, holding time and gate freeze time. Ensure the gate remains open long enough for proper packing.

⚠️ Gate Blush is often confused with Jetting. Jetting produces snake-like flow marks extending into the cavity, while Gate Blush remains localized around the gate.

⚠️ If reducing the initial injection speed significantly improves the defect, excessive shear at the gate is usually the root cause.

⚠️ Gate Blush is especially common on cosmetic parts where surface appearance is critical. These parts are often molded through very small pinpoint gates, making the gate area particularly susceptible to this defect.
